Parameter descriptions
With the parameters Analog: Voltage 100% 551 and Analog: Voltage 0%552, the voltage range at
100% and 0% of the output parameter is set. If the output value exceeds the reference value, the
output voltage also exceeds the value of the parameter
Analog: Voltage 100%551 up to the maxi-
mum value of 22 V (or the maximum value of an external voltage supply).
NOTE
If Operation Mode MFO1 (X13.6) 550 = Analog (PWM) MFO1A and parameter s Ana-
log: Voltage 100% 551 < Analog: Voltage 0% 552, then the smaller voltage value of
Analog: Voltage 100% 551 is put out.
553 Analog: Source MFO1A
If the multifunction output is to be used as analog output, parameter
Operation Mode MFO1
(X13.6)
550 must be set to "10 - Analog (PWM) MFO1A".
For parameter
Analog: Source MFO1A 553, the analog actual value to be output at the multifunction
output can be selected.

Select an analog signal source.
Analog: Source MFO1A 553
Function
0 -
Off
Analog mode at the multifunction output is switched off.
1 -
Abs. Fs
Abs. value of the stator frequency. 0.00 Hz ... Maximum Fre-
quency 419.
2 -
Abs. Fs betw. fmin/fmax
Abs. value of the stator frequency. Minimum Frequency 418...
Maximum Frequency 419.
7 -
Abs. Actual Frequency
Abs. value of act. frequency. 0.00 Hz ... Maximum Frequency
419. Factory setting.
10 -
Abs. Reference Percentage
Absolute value of reference value from reference percentage
channel. Total of Reference Percentage Source 1 476 and Refer-
ence Percentage Source 2 494.
11 -
Abs. Ref. Percentage betw.
%min/%max
Absolute value of reference value from reference percentage
channel. Minimum Reference Percentage 518 … Maximum Ref-
erence Percentage
519. Total of Reference Percentage Source
1 476 and Reference Percentage Source 2 494.
20 -
Abs. Iactive
Abs. value of current effective current I
Active
. 0.0 A ... Nominal
frequency inverter current.
21 -
Abs. Isd
Abs. value of flux-forming current component. 0.0 A ... Nominal
frequency inverter current.
22 -
Abs. Isq
Abs. value of torque-forming current component. 0.0 A ... Nomi-
nal frequency inverter current.
30 -
Abs. Pactive
Abs. value of current effective power P
Active
. 0.0 kW ... Rated
Mech. Power 376.
31 -
Abs. T
Abs. value of calculated torque M, 0.0 Nm ... rated torque.
32 -
Abs. Inside Temperature
Abs. value of measured inside temperature. -20 °C ... 100 °C.
33 -
Abs. Heat Sink Tempera-
ture
Abs. value of measured heat sink temperature. -20 °C ... 100 °C.
34 -
Abs. Capacitor temperature
Abs. value of measured capacitor temperature. -20 °C ... 100 °C.
40 -
Abs. Analog Input MFI1A
Abs. signal value at analog input MFI1A. DC 0.0 V ... 10.0 V.
41 -
Abs. Analog Input MFI2A
Abs. signal value at analog input MFI2A. DC 0.0 V ... 10.0 V.
50 -
Abs. I
Abs. current value of measured output currents. 0.0 A ... Nominal
frequency inverter current.
51 -
DC-Link Voltage
DC-link voltage U
d
. DC 0.0 V ... 1000.0 V.
52 -
V
Output voltage. 3xAC 0.0 V ... 1000.0 V.
